Output 82b6de1435072f2d96eb979230b1a10171ccbaeee8d2fbe3686cb3a2abf5dfd4:1

value
19829186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 375c0acf30fe9050c589e51f402eb01275b59c57 OP_EQUAL
address
MCwsfBnJwuGAgByh7CeTkSUpt5KUMBYHAt
transaction
82b6de1435072f2d96eb979230b1a10171ccbaeee8d2fbe3686cb3a2abf5dfd4
spent
true